Abstract
Based on the previous and ongoing work of the development of GSG, an extensible expert system shell tool to support creative work involving shape computing with Shape Grammars, this paper shows an evolution and refinement of the system. A refined class structure and the line intersections types appropriate for matching shapes in the process of shape grammar rule application are presented. Operations for the algebras of shapes (which are essential in the mechanics of the application of rules in shape computing) are discussed, for both maximal and non maximal shapes. In particular, details and tests of the implementation of these operations for the maximal case are also shown.
